The Premier League starts with the Merseyside derby, as Everton host Liverpool at Goodison Park.
Everton are desperate to register their first Premier League win of the season, and are sure to start quickly, trying to pressure their cross-city rivals with an aggressive press. While they are still winless, there are signs of life for Frank Lampard’s side, particularly in attack with the pace of Anthony Gordon.
Liverpool haven’t yet hit their stride as we have seen in recent seasons, and have made a recent habit of starting slowly in a number of games so far this season. They conceded first to Fulham, Crystal Palace, Manchester United and Newcastle, often being caught on the break.

The late game comes from the Midlands, as Aston Villa host Manchester City.
Villa boss Steven Gerrard is under pressure, with results and performances really poor to start the season. He’s going to find it very difficult to arrest the slump this evening, with the defending champions Manchester City in town.
City, by contrast, have looked peerless at times this season, and enter this game on the back of scoring six against Nottingham Forest and four against Crystal Palace. New striker Erling Haarland scored a hattrick in both games, but could be rested with one eye on Sevilla in the Champions League next week.
Although the pressure is mounting on Gerrard the players still appear to be behind him. This could lead to a committed performance, even though it may not be enough to claim a point. New captain John McGinn will want to lead by example in the key area of midfield.
